Output dad44788642d177f9240ce745011da63f22d30cbe971c26917d3759fb1c033e3:1

value
688804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65358472f0521311f44325336e3e52453fa5ea50 OP_EQUAL
address
3AvAHNVHwYXKzyXwPipWNRDKZFgNzXctTg
transaction
dad44788642d177f9240ce745011da63f22d30cbe971c26917d3759fb1c033e3
confirmations
307163
spent
true